Production Suspended on ‘Survivor Greece’ Following Serious Contestant Injury

The production of Survivor Greece has been brought to an abrupt halt following a severe accident involving a contestant. The incident, which occurred during the filming of the reality competition series, resulted in a participant suffering a life-altering injury.

Details of the Incident

Reports confirm that the production, which airs on Skai TV, has been suspended indefinitely. The contestant, identified as 21-year-old Stavros Floros, sustained a serious injury while participating in activities related to the show. According to multiple sources, the accident involved a boat propeller, leading to the loss of a portion of the contestant’s leg.

The incident reportedly took place while the contestant was engaged in spearfishing. Following the accident, the individual was transported for emergency medical treatment. In the wake of the tragedy, the network and production team made the decision to cease all filming operations.

Impact on the Production

The suspension of Survivor Greece marks a significant moment for the long-running franchise. Reality television production carries inherent risks, particularly when filming in remote or maritime environments. While protocols are typically established to manage safety during physical challenges, this event has prompted an immediate shutdown of the current season.

Skai TV has not yet provided a detailed timeline for a potential resumption of the program, and the future of the current season remains uncertain as the network prioritizes the wellbeing of the cast and addresses the circumstances surrounding the accident.
